Kiel forigi EOF-dosieron en Unikso?

Kiel vi forigas la finon de dosiero en Unikso?

Vi povas forigi la novlinian signon ĉe la fino de dosiero uzante la jenan facilan manieron:

  1. kapo -c -1 dosiero. De man kapo : -c, –bytes=[-]K presi la unuajn K bajtojn de ĉiu dosiero; kun la ĉefa '-', presi ĉiujn krom la lastaj K bajtoj de ĉiu dosiero.
  2. detranĉi -s -1 dosieron.

11 jan. 2016

Kial EOF estas uzata en Unikso?

: ĝi estas uzata en ĉeno, metita ĉe la fino de ĉiu ĉeno por reprezenti la finon de la ĉeno, ASCII-valoro estas 0. EOF: Ĝi estas uzata en dosiero por reprezenti la finon de la dosiero, ASCII-valoro estas -1. Kiel vi uzas enigon kiel komandon (ŝelo, xargs, fish, Unikso)?

Kio estas EOF-karaktero en Linukso?

En Unikso/Linukso, ĉiu linio en dosiero havas End-Of-Line (EOL) karakteron kaj la EOF-signo estas post la lasta linio. En fenestroj, ĉiu linio havas EOL-signojn krom la lasta linio. Do la lasta linio de unix/linukso dosiero estas. aĵoj, EOL, EOF. dum la lasta linio de Windows-dosiero, se la kursoro estas sur la linio, estas.

Kiel mi forigas karakteron en Unikso?

Forigu CTRL-M signojn de dosiero en UNIX

  1. La plej facila maniero estas verŝajne uzi la stream-redaktilon sed por forigi la ^ M-signojn. Tajpu ĉi tiun komandon:% sed -e “s / ^ M //” dosiernomo> nova dosiernomo. ...
  2. Vi ankaŭ povas fari ĝin en vi:% vi dosiernomo. Ene vi [en ESC-reĝimo] tajpu::% s / ^ M // g. ...
  3. Vi ankaŭ povas fari ĝin ene de Emakso. Por fari tion, sekvu ĉi tiujn paŝojn:

25 июл. 2011 г.

Kiel vi tranĉas ŝnuron en Unikso?

Por tranĉi per signo uzu la opcion -c. Ĉi tio elektas la signojn donitajn al la opcio -c. Ĉi tio povas esti listo de komoj apartigitaj nombroj, gamo da nombroj aŭ ununura nombro.

Kion signifas EOF?

En komputado, fino de dosiero (EOF) estas kondiĉo en komputila operaciumo kie ne pli da datumoj povas esti legitaj de datenfonto. La datumfonto estas kutime nomita dosiero aŭ rivereto.

Kio estas << en Unikso?

< estas uzata por redirekti enigaĵon. Dirante komandon < dosiero. plenumas komandon kun dosiero kiel enigo. La << sintakso estas referita kiel ĉi tie dokumento. La ĉeno sekvanta << estas limigilo indikanta la komencon kaj finon de la ĉi tiea dokumento.

Kio estas kato EOF?

La EOF-funkciigisto estas uzata en multaj programlingvoj. Ĉi tiu operatoro signifas la finon de la dosiero. ... La komando "kato", sekvata de la dosiernomo, permesas al vi vidi la enhavon de iu ajn dosiero en la Linuksa terminalo.

Kiel vi sendas EOF?

Vi povas ĝenerale "eksigi EOF" en programo funkcianta en terminalo per CTRL + D klavopremo tuj post la lasta enigo fluso.

Kia datumtipo estas EOF?

EOF ne estas signo, sed stato de la dosiertenilo. Dum ekzistas kontrolsignoj en la ASCII-signaro, kiu reprezentas la finon de la datumoj, ĉi tiuj ne estas uzataj por signali la finon de dosieroj ĝenerale. Ekzemple EOT (^D) kiu en kelkaj kazoj preskaŭ signalas la samon.

Kiel mi uzas EOF en terminalo?

  1. EOF estas envolvita en makroo pro kialo - vi neniam bezonas scii la valoron.
  2. De la komandlinio, kiam vi funkcias vian programon, vi povas sendi EOF al la programo per Ctrl - D (Unikso) aŭ CTRL - Z (Mikrosofto).
  3. Por determini kian valoron de EOF estas sur via platformo, vi ĉiam povas simple presi ĝin: printf ("%in", EOF);

15 aŭg. 2012 г.

Kiel mi forigas la lastan signon de linio en Unikso?

Por forigi la lastan signon. Kun la aritmetika esprimo ( $5+0 ) ni devigas awk interpreti la 5-an kampon kiel nombron, kaj io ajn post la nombro estos ignorita. (vosto preterlasas la kapliniojn kaj tr forigas ĉion krom la ciferoj kaj la liniolimigiloj). La sintakso estas s(anstataŭa)/serĉo/anstataŭigi ĉenon/ .

Kio estas M en Linukso?

Vidante la atestildosierojn en Linukso montras ^M-signojn almetitajn al ĉiu linio. La koncerna dosiero estis kreita en Vindozo kaj poste kopiita al Linukso. ^M estas la klavaro ekvivalenta al r aŭ CTRL-v + CTRL-m en vim.

Kiel mi forigas duoblajn citilojn en Unikso?

2 Respondoj

  1. sed ‘s/”//g’ forigas ĉiujn citilojn sur ĉiu linio.
  2. sed ‘s/^/”/’ aldonas duoblan citilon komence de ĉiu linio.
  3. sed ‘s/$/”/’ aldonas duoblan citilon ĉe la fino de ĉiu linio.
  4. sed ‘s/|/”|”/g’ aldonas citaĵon antaŭ kaj post ĉiu pipo.
  5. REDAKTO: Laŭ la komento pri tuba apartigilo, ni devas iomete ŝanĝi la komandon.

22 okt. 2015 g.

Ĉu vi ŝatas ĉi tiun afiŝon? Bonvolu dividi al viaj amikoj:
OS Hodiaŭ